Below is our recent interview with Mikael Johnsson, Co-Founder and Partner at Growth Capital firm Oxx:

Mikael Johnsson

Q: Why did you launch Oxx?

A: My cofounder Richard Anton and I have been investing in Software-as-a-Service (SaaS) companies from the U.K., Nordics and Israel for almost two decades. Over that time, we’ve gathered a lot of experience in growing SaaS companies. We often say that we help companies in danger of getting stuck in ‘the valley of death’ – we’ve seen so many exciting companies who reach a modest size but fail to internationalise and thus never reach their full potential. We wanted to launch a dedicated growth capital firm that applies our years of learnings and helps these promising SaaS companies find not only capital, but also the necessary network and deep sector expertise required to scale up.

Q: What is your approach to working with entrepreneurs?

A: At Oxx we are really entrepreneur-led and hands-on – working with passionate entrepreneurs is one of the best parts of what we do. We like to think of ourselves as taking the role of producer in the production of a movie: we’re not the star and we’re not the director, but take responsibility for the show becoming a success. We do this by supporting entrepreneurs, bringing board members and advisors into play and acting as a sounding board and coach to management, particularly on how to enter and succeed in major markets like the US.

A member of our investment team will almost always sit on the company’s board and provide ongoing advice to ensure that the business scales in the way it plans to. This close relationship is at the very heart of the service that Oxx provides for its portfolio companies.

Q: What should entrepreneurs think about when scaling up?

A: Scaling your business can be a daunting task, but preparation, experience and support is really important in helping you succeed. Make sure you cover your bases: have you checked out your competitors in depth? Have you hired the very best team you can afford? Are you measuring your progress with metrics relevant to you?

An important early priority is determining how you will generate the right sales leads. Get your demand generation strategy in place with your CMO and one or two business development-focused salespeople who are on the ground before you hire a large, traditional sales team. For Oxx’s companies, internationalising is a major focus and we use our relationships, sector-specific knowledge and networks to support our entrepreneurs to build and execute a scaling strategy.

Q: What are your target markets and why?

A: At Oxx, we focus exclusively on scaling B2B SaaS companies originating in Europe and Israel and building out in the US. We are primarily focused on companies originating in the Nordics, UK and Israel because of our particularly strong networks and experience here. Our goal is to take our portfolio companies from local heroes to global players. We’re strict about exclusively working with B2B software companies because we think it’s really important to provide entrepreneurs with exceptional support. That means investing in companies we understand really well and have real experience scaling. In terms of finance, we typically invest in companies with traction, who have a proven business model and revenues of $5m – $20m.
